meaning of dewberry

1. The fruit of certain species of bramble (Rubus); in England, the fruit of R. caesius, which has a glaucous bloom; in America, that of R. canadensis and R. hispidus, species of low blackberries.
2.
The plant which bears the fruit.
3.
blackberry-like fruits of any of several trailing blackberry bushes


Related Words

dewberry | dewberry bush |

Developed & Maintained By Taraprasad.com

Treasure Words